Importance of Trip Registration at the Estonia Embassy

Registering your trip with the Estonia embassy is crucial for ensuring your safety and well-being while abroad. In cases of natural disasters, political unrest, or medical emergencies, being registered helps the embassy maintain communication with you. For instance, if a sudden earthquake strikes or there are protests leading to civil disorder, registration allows authorities to quickly locate and assist you.

In the unfortunate situation of a medical emergency, the embassy can provide vital support, including connecting you to local healthcare facilities or offering advice on available medical options. Knowing that the embassy has your travel information fosters a sense of security, allowing you to focus on enjoying your time abroad rather than worrying about potential crises.

Estonia Embassy FAQs

  • Can the Estonia embassy assist in legal issues abroad?
    Yes, the Estonia embassy can provide assistance in legal matters by offering guidance on local laws and connecting you with local legal resources.

  • What should I do if I lose my Estonia passport in Senegal?
    If you lose your Estonia passport in Senegal, report the loss to local authorities and then contact the Estonia embassy for assistance in obtaining a replacement passport.

  • Can the embassy help with travel safety tips?
    Yes, the Estonia embassy provides travel alerts and safety updates to help travelers stay informed about any potential risks in the region.

  • What financial assistance can the embassy provide?
    While the embassy cannot provide direct financial assistance, it may help you connect with local resources or your family for support.
